New Skewer x Last Street Art in Crystal Palace

A month or so back saw graffiti writers Skewer and Last take to Crystal Palace to paint the first town spot for our community endeavors in 2024. Presenting a fantastic fun work – who doesn’t love dinosaurs? We have a harmonious collaboration of each artist’s respective styles, with Last painting the Stegosaurus on the left and Skewer painting the accompanying Triceratops skull on the right, both set in a lush cascading valley setting. Not only is the work so much fun, it is a superb addition for the area, something which was not lost on the locals, as just a stones throw away are the iconic Crystal Palace dinosaurs. The dinosaurs in question are a series of sculptures which were unveiled in 1854 following the move of the Crystal Palace to the area after the Great Exhibition in Hyde Park, and are dotted around the lake in the nearby Crystal Palace Park.
